Mallow see off Cork champions

Mallow 2-9 Castlehaven 1-10

A performance rich in character, highlighted by a quality goal from centre-forward David Lavin, swept Mallow to a memorable victory and a quarter-final meeting with Aghada.

In the first game at Macroom, Bishopstown ended the fairytale for Ilen Rovers when James O'Shea's last gasp point earned the cityside a slender 0-11 to 0-10 victory and they now face O'Donovan Rossa in the quarter-finals.

On a miserable weekend for West Cork teams, their divisional representatives Carbery kept the flag flying with a narrow 0-13 to 1-9 win over CIT at Kilmurry last evening.

In the Cork IFC Ballinora had to toil mightily for their 1-10 to 1-7 quarter-final victory over Carrigaline at Bandon on Saturday, recovering from lethargic starts in both halves to book a semi-final date with either Carbery Rangers or Macroom.

In the Cork U-21 FC, Kildorrery had a 1-6 to 1-5 victory over Beara at Inchigeelagh, O'Donovan Rossa beat Ballincollig 1-11 to 0-5 at Ballineen, while champions St. Nicholas lost their crown, losing 0-14 to 1-4 to Nemo Rangers in the City final replay at Pairc Ui Rinn.
